These are SkillSpector’s own severities. On a checked sample its high-severity flags on skills were ~96% false positives — a documented command, a public API, a “never do X” rule — so we show them as a caution to read, not a verdict. Why →
- medium MCP Rug Pull · line 15 npx commands without a version suffix (e.g. @1.0.0) create a rug-pull risk if the upstream server is compromised and publishes a malicious update.Fix: Pin the version: npx @scope/[email protected]

Brand Protection — Amazon 🛡️
Protect your brand from hijackers, counterfeits, and unauthorized sellers on Amazon.
Installation
npx skills add nexscope-ai/eCommerce-Skills --skill brand-protection-amazon -g
Features
- Hijacker Detection — Find unauthorized sellers on your listings
- Price Monitoring — MAP violation alerts
- Counterfeit Signals — Review-based fake detection
- Trademark Abuse — Title/keyword infringement detection
- Complaint Templates — Brand Registry, C&D letters
- Test Buy Guide — Evidence collection procedure
Detection Dimensions
| Dimension | Method | Risk Level |
|---|---|---|
| Hijackers | Seller count monitoring | 🔴 High |
| Price Violations | Below MAP detection | 🔴 High |
| Counterfeit | Review keyword analysis | 🔴 High |
| Trademark | Title pattern matching | ⚠️ Medium |
Risk Levels
| Level | Description | Action |
|---|---|---|
| 🔴 High | Immediate threat to brand | Take action within 24h |
| ⚠️ Medium | Potential concern | Monitor and investigate |
| ✅ Low | Normal activity | Continue monitoring |
